Maykol Isidro Vidales Alvarado
3×3 · top 52.7% of 284,439 all-time · competing since July 2014 · 2014ALVA09
Maykol Isidro Vidales Alvarado has been competing for 12 years. His best event is the 3×3: a personal-best single of 25.03, set at Rubik Zacatecas 2017, puts him in the top 52.7% of the 284,439 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 2,782nd in Mexico. Across 3 competitions since July 2014, he has put 31 official solves on the record across four events. His 3×3 best has come down from 32.58 in July 2014 to 25.03, a 23% improvement. Maykol has entered three competitions, more competitions than 69%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
